Stipulations and Entry Specifications
To enrol in a regular swimming pool lifeguard system, candidates are frequently expected to fulfill the next:

Be no less than sixteen several years previous (some applications take 15-year-olds with consent)

Have the ability to swim 200 metres in lower than six minutes

Be effective at retrieving a 5kg item from the bottom of the pool (2m deep)

Have superior verbal conversation and literacy in English

Be moderately fit and bodily able to dealing with rescue duties

Assembly these needs ensures that trainees can properly conduct rescues and reply in large-pressure cases.

System Articles: What You'll Study
Swimming pool lifeguard programs include a combination of classroom classes, pool-primarily based practicals, and situation testing.

Common program units include:

Present Initial Assist (HLTAID011)

Provide CPR (HLTAID009)

Supervise Swimming Pool End users (SISCAQU027)

Accomplish Fundamental Water Rescues (SISCAQU022)

Complete H2o Rescues (SISCAQU020)

Topics contain:

Rescue procedures: arrive at, toss, As well as in-water assists

Surveillance methods: scanning, zoning, and positioning

Crisis response: motion programs, alert methods, interaction

Coping with spinal accidents in the h2o

Pool basic safety methods and danger assessments

How to manage hard patrons or unexpected emergency situations

Assessment involves penned checks, timed swims, simulated emergencies, and team things to do.

How much time Does the Study course Acquire?
Most classes acquire two–3 entire days to complete, according to the instruction provider. Some offer blended Discovering formats with pre-system reading through or on-line modules accompanied by realistic sessions.

Classes are frequently delivered in Group leisure centres, aquatic services, or training colleges. Weekend and holiday break system dates tend to be accessible to fit learners or Doing work participants.

Price of a Swimming Pool Lifeguard Course
The associated fee varies by company and location, but most programs range involving $250 and $400. This usually incorporates:

Program instruction and materials

Realistic assessments

Very first support and CPR units

Statement of Attainment upon completion

Some companies or councils could subsidise fees for persons applying to operate inside their aquatic centres. It’s well worth checking for community applications or career-joined sponsorships.

Certification Validity and Ongoing Demands
Lifeguard skills are certainly not lifelong—competencies should be refreshed.

CPR models will have to ordinarily be renewed every twelve months

Full lifeguard recertification is often demanded each individual two–three several years

Ongoing in-provider education is usually Portion of employment in aquatic centres

Keeping your certification current makes sure you might be constantly updated with the latest safety protocols and rescue solutions.
